Mansory's top-of-the-line luxury models are often exaggerated, and the large use of carbon fiber gives it the nickname of a carbon seller. And it will also bring more exaggerated and fanatical DIY design modifications according to special consumers. Recently, Mansory once again released a new modification case, the model is the Ferrari 812 GTS version launched in March 2021. However, this time the modding style is different from the Ferrari 812 GTS modification previously released by Mansory, which previously introduced silver and blue theme tones, and this time adopted a more dynamic orange body color.

Just like the silver version, the Mansory Stallone is equipped with countless carbon fiber parts that make the front end look extremely aggressive, the exaggerated wind knife shape is more like a racing car, and the same is true of the rear of the body, with a huge tail wing occupying the entire rear trim, and a new four-out exhaust system.

Unlike the previous version, this time The Manor brought the same design style as the body and interior, with orange trims on the dashboard, seats, door cards and centre console, carbon fiber cover plates everywhere in the cabin, and aluminum pedals to enhance the press.

In terms of power, Mansory squeezed more power out of the 6.5-liter engine. It can now produce 830 hp (610 kW) and 740 Nm of torque, resulting in a modification with a 2.8-second 100-km/h acceleration time and a top speed of 214 mph (345 km/h). Mansory doesn't list the price of a retrofit, but like most of its products, most people can't afford to retrofit it.
